Is this the one?
At 22 feet long by 7.5 feet wide by 6 feet high, the 30 yard is roughly nine pickup truck loads — and that extra wall height is where its advantage lies: volume for a genuine construction or remodeling project. Framing offcuts, drywall, cabinetry, flooring, insulation, furniture and general clearance from a full gut job all belong here, alongside new-construction job sites and commercial fit-outs from downtown Bakersfield out to Shafter and Wasco.
The caveat is weight, and it is a real one. The allowance is generous but finite, and dense material burns through it while the box still looks half empty — which is exactly why concrete, dirt, brick and tile never go in a 30. If a renovation is turning up that kind of heavy debris alongside the lighter stuff, we will run a 10 or 15 alongside the 30 rather than try to fit it all in one container. A 30 also needs open, level ground — most Bakersfield driveways handle it without trouble, and it can sit on the street instead with a City of Bakersfield Public Works permit, which we handle before delivery if that is the only option. If the job is in Shafter, Wasco, Delano or Arvin, that town runs its own permit process instead of the City of Bakersfield's, and we will confirm which one applies before the truck rolls.
Straight advice: Take this one for volume, never for weight. If concrete, dirt, brick or tile is part of the pile, pair the 30 with a 10 or 15 for that portion rather than loading it in here — and keep everything below the top rail regardless of what is going in.

Same flat pricing model across all five. The real question is which weight allowance matches your material — heavy debris, roofing, or a construction phase.
| Size | Dimensions | Capacity | Weight included | Best for |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 10 Yard Dumpster | 14 ft long × 7.5 ft wide × 3.5 ft high | about 3 pickup truck loads | 1–2 tons | Small cleanouts, single-room gut jobs, concrete and heavy debris, roofing up to about 15 squares. |
| 15 Yard Dumpster | 16 ft long × 7.5 ft wide × 4.5 ft high | about 4–5 pickup truck loads | 2–3 tons | Garage and basement cleanouts, kitchen remodels, medium roof tear-offs, yard waste and landscaping debris. |
| 20 Yard Dumpster | 22 ft long × 7.5 ft wide × 4.5 ft high | about 6 pickup truck loads | 3–4 tons | Whole-home cleanouts, flooring and siding jobs, large tear-offs, drywall and remodel debris. |
| 30 Yard Dumpster | 22 ft long × 7.5 ft wide × 6 ft high | about 9 pickup truck loads | 4–5 tons | Full gut renovations, new construction, estate clearances, commercial fit-outs and demolition. |
| 40 Yard Dumpster | 22 ft long × 7.5 ft wide × 8 ft high | about 12 pickup truck loads | 5–6 tons | Large commercial fit-outs, industrial clear-outs, major renovations and high-volume light debris. |

About 22 ft long by 7.5 ft wide by 6 ft high — the same footprint as the 40, just two feet shorter on the walls. It needs open, level ground; a driveway is ideal for most jobs.
Yes — 20, 30 and 40 yard containers are the ones we suit to construction and remodeling work, and the 30 is the volume workhorse of the three for a full gut renovation, an addition, or new construction.
No — that heavy material stays in a 10 or 15 yard container regardless of what else is coming out of the job. If a renovation is producing both, we will run a smaller container alongside the 30 for the heavy portion.
Not if it sits on your driveway or another private surface — that is where most 30 yard containers land. If the site genuinely requires the street or sidewalk instead, we pull the City of Bakersfield Public Works placement permit before delivery, or the local permit if the job is in Lamont, McFarland or Tehachapi.
